#2115e0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2115e0 is composed of 12.9% red, 8.2%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.3% cyan, 90.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 243.5 degrees, a saturation of 82.9% and a lightness of 48%. #2115e0 color hex could be obtained by blending #422aff with #0000c1.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#2115e0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2115e0 has RGB values of R:33, G:21, B:224 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.91, Y:0,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 2168288.
